About the Role

Assist in the management of the ongoing compliance with prudential regulations applying to all Rathbones subsidiary businesses. Regulations include but not limited to MIFIDPRU / IPRU-INV / IFR & IFD / JFSC and GFSC capital and liquidity rules.

Assist with the production of ICARAs/ICAAPS Wind-down plans public disclosure documents and key committee packs collaborating with executives in the subsidiaries to ensure regulatory requirements are understood and embedded in decision making.

What youll be responsible for

  • Assist with the management of regulatory compliance with the different prudential regulatory regimes across all relevant subsidiaries of the group including but not limited to production of the annual ICARA/ICARAP process and disclosures ongoing capital and liquidity requirement assessment and frequent review of the nature and value of risks of harm.
  • Assist with the timely and accurate production of regulatory reporting according to the principles set out in regulatory reporting governance framework including the implementation of new reporting requirements and responding to any ad-hoc requests for data from the regulators.
  • Co-ordinate production and analysis of relevant MI from both a commercial and risk-based perspective for onwards reporting to the Senior Group Treasury & ALM Controller executive committees and board.
  • Engage with treasury and capital teams to set out the modelling requirements for liquidity and capital for ICARA/ICARAP purposes resulting in the teams providing adequate forecasting and stress outputs to support the ICARA and ICARAP process.
  • Support the annual review (or more frequently if required) of risk tolerances recommending changes where appropriate and ensuring calibration methodology is clear.
  • Production of regulatory returns where the Prudential Regulation team are the assigned owners in accordance with requirements of the regulatory reporting governance framework.
  • Maintain procedures reflecting changes as they occur and testing where appropriate.
  • Support the review of the regulatory reporting governance framework policy on at least an annual basis to ensure they remain relevant to current external climate and capture all risks appropriately.
  • Support the production of public disclosures engaging with key stakeholders to refresh both quantitative and qualitative material and ensuring disclosures comply with regulatory requirements.
  • Co-ordinate production and analysis of regulatory reporting positions ready for submission to the Capital performance forum Banking Committee and other subsidiary committees.
